Baltimoreit’s that time again!

Maryland Wellness Presents, “Wellness Boutique”, a wonderful event for our Baltimore community to explore a fantastic selection of complimentary clothing and shoes for men, women, children, and babies.

Come join us, meet our friendly staff, and learn more about our organization and the mental health resources we offer.

We’re also providing complimentary groceries! If you’re interested or would like to pick up for a friend, click on this link to complete our grocery pick-up form.

Mark your calendars for Thursday, August 22nd, 2024.

The event will be held from 10:00 AM to 2:00 PM at 4128 Hayward Avenue, Baltimore, Maryland 21215.
